Taban Deng Gai’s Camp Disintegrating As Senior Officials Defect

Feb 28, 2017(Nyamilepedia) —— A break away faction of SPLM/A (in
Opposition) under the leadership of Gen. Taban Deng Gai, who
collaborates with Salva Kiir government, has began to disintegrate.
Within the last two weeks, the camp which is made up of loosely allied
politicians has suffered major defections while Taban undergoes
medical treatment in Europe, according to insiders.
Among the recent defections is Maj. Gen. Khamis Abdelatif Chawul, an
outspoken senior politician, who joins the opposition in January 2015.
Declaration his defection in Juba, Gen. Khamis accused Gen. Taban of
being “the most tribalist Nuer politician” he has ever seen in his
life.
Gen. Khamis accuses Taban of lacking a vision for the country and said
he [Taban] is being used to implement government’s programs.
The former negotiator of SPLM/A-IO, Taban Deng Gai, controversially
replaced Dr. Machar as the First Vice President in July 2016 and went
on to appoint his own officials, mostly from his Nuer community.
According to critics, Taban’s appointments were strategically chosen
to lure majority of Nuer tribe to Juba to support Salva Kiir’s
government and to isolate Dr. Riek Machar Teny among the Nuer tribe;
however, only a handful politicians and less than 1% of military
generals accepted Machar’s forceful replacement.
Since July 2016, vast majority of SPLM/A-IO advance team and
supporters, who returned to Juba to implement the peace agreement,
have sneaked out of the capital to weight war against the government.
Senior politicians like Lt. Gen. Gabriel Duop Lam have defected and
rejoined the SPLM/A-IO.
Taban Group Regrets Gen. Khamis’ Defection
Responding to Gen. Khamis’ defection, SPLM/A-Taban camp regrets such a
decision but said it’s okay he can defect to join whatever political
camp he wishes as long as such decision will not fuel the conflict.
“We regret the resignation of Gen. Khamis Abdelatif Chawul from the
SPLM/A-IO. Khamis was a committed member of SPLM/A-IO. However, as a
politician he has a right to decide on the current political matters
that are facing the country as long as his action don’t involve
violence” Said Dr. Dhieu Mathok Ding, the Secretary of SPLM/A-Taban
defection.
Dhieu went on to assures Gen. Khamis that their group is still
committed to work with Salva Kiir government to implement the peace
agreement.
Khamis would be the third highest politician to have defected from the
camp within the last two weeks following defection of Lt. Gen. Gabriel
Duop and recently speculated defection of Lt. Gen. Alfred Lado Gore.
